Command-line client for the IB1 Directory member API. Built to make the API easy to exercise as it grows, and to be drivable by scripts and code agents (machine-readable output, real exit codes, no prompts).
Authenticate either by logging in (browser, authorization-code + PKCE, token cached in
the OS keyring) or by pasting a token (--token / DIRECTORY_TOKEN) for short runs and
CI.

The default API is the sandbox. Point --api-url or DIRECTORY_API_URL at another
environment, or at http://localhost:8000 for a locally running API.
Login needs no configuration beyond the API URL. directory login asks the API for its
Cognito hosted UI domain, client id and scopes (GET /.well-known/directory-cli). These optional
variables override what the API publishes, e.g. against an API that doesn't publish it:

The API is only asked when DIRECTORY_COGNITO_DOMAIN and DIRECTORY_COGNITO_CLIENT_ID aren't
both set.
directory login # opens a browser, caches the token in your OS keyring
directory logout # clears the cached token for this API
directory token # prints a current id token (refreshing if needed)After directory login, me get / me update use the cached token automatically. Token
precedence is --token then DIRECTORY_TOKEN then the keyring cache.
Tokens are cached per API URL, so you can be logged in to several environments at once and
--api-url picks which token is used. The Cognito client that issued a token is cached with
it, so refreshing the token doesn't call the API.
directory token is the bridge for agents/CI that can't open a browser: a human runs it and
passes the value as DIRECTORY_TOKEN. The token is short-lived, so this suits short runs.

Most users own a single organisation and need nothing extra. Some own several — for example an
energy data provider that also owns an example CAP organisation, which it acts as to generate test
certificates. List the ones you own, then pass --organization <identifier> (or set
DIRECTORY_ORGANIZATION) on any command to say which one you are acting as.
# List the organisations you own
directory me orgs
# Act as a specific organisation
directory --organization cap12345 me get
directory --organization cap12345 cert sign abc12345 client
# Or set it once for the session
export DIRECTORY_ORGANIZATION=cap12345
directory me getIf you own more than one organisation and don't pass a selector, the API returns an error asking you
to pick one. There is no -o short flag for --organization because -o is the output-path flag on
ca download and cert download.

# Sign a certificate for an application. With no --csr, a private key and CSR are
# generated locally; the key is written to disk (mode 0600) and the signed cert saved.
directory cert sign abc12345 client
# → my-app writes abc12345-client-key.pem and abc12345-client-cert.pem, prints the cert id
# Use your own CSR instead of generating one (no key is written):
directory cert sign abc12345 signing --csr my.csr --cert-out signing.pem
# Download a certificate by id (default filename comes from the server)
directory cert download <certificate-id> -o cert.pem
# Revoke a certificate (destructive, so --yes is required; this is a soft revoke)
directory cert revoke <certificate-id> --yescert sign takes the application identifier and the type (client or signing). The CA
forces the certificate subject to your organisation regardless of the CSR, so a generated
CSR's subject does not matter. Download the CA root/intermediate bundle with
directory ca download <client|signing>.

Interactive login needs a public Cognito app client on the existing user pool:
- no client secret
- authorization-code grant with PKCE
- callback URL
http://localhost:8400/callback(the exact port must matchDIRECTORY_REDIRECT_PORT) - scopes
openid email
The API it logs in to must then be configured with:
COGNITO_ALLOWED_CLIENT_IDSincluding the client id, so the API accepts tokens it issuesCOGNITO_DOMAINandCOGNITO_CLI_CLIENT_ID, so the API publishes them at/.well-known/directory-clifor the CLI to discover
These are deploy/infra steps (AWS and the deployments repo), not part of the CLI.
